Thank you. Just caught this on cable, and I'm glad somebody else picked up on that. The writer apparently thinks that high tide comes 12 hours after low tide. As Jeff points, out, there are two sets of high and low tides per day. High tide follows low tide by 6 hours (and 12 minutes), not 12 hours.
